ERLEDIGT
JA
JA
ANTWORTEN
2
2
ZUGRIFFE
953
953
EMPFEHLEN
-
Hallo,
habe folgendes Problem.
Haben ein Lottozahlen Programm programmiert und sollen nun die Zahlen die das Programm "ausspuckt" noch sortieren lassen mit dem Bubblesort Algorythmus.
Ich habe keinen blassen Schimmer wie ich dies tun soll.
Hier der bereits vorhandene Quellcode vom Lottozahlen Programm :
Code :1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35
Private Sub cmdStart_Click() Dim i As Integer Dim intZahlen(6) As Integer Dim a As Integer lstlotto.Clear Const DEF_Max = 49 i = 1 Do Randomize intZahlen(i) = Int(Rnd() * DEF_Max) + 1 'Innere Schleife For a = 1 To i If intZahlen(i) = intZahlen(a) And a <> i Then i = i - 1 Exit For End If Next i = i + 1 Loop Until i > 6 i = 1 Do lstlotto.AddItem intZahlen(i) i = i + 1 Loop Until i > 6 End Sub
Danke schonmal im vorraus
-
02.02.11 10:46 #2
- Registriert seit
- Sep 2004
- Ort
- Möglingen (BaWü)
- Beiträge
- 3.109
Also wenn du jetzt den Code suchtst, dann schau zum Beispiel mal hier:
http://msdn.microsoft.com/de-de/library/bb979305.aspxSollte ein Tipp von mir geholfen haben, habe ich nichts gegen eine entsprechende Bewertung oder ein Danke und wenn ein Problem gelöst ist, dann den Beitrag bitte auch als erledigt markieren.
Was ich gar nicht leiden kann sind User die es nicht für nötig halten auf Antworten zu reagieren, die Themen nicht als erledigt markieren und/oder die sich nicht für Hilfe bedanken.
-
Danke hab es.
Quellcode:
Code :1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50
Private Sub cmdStart_Click() Dim i As Integer Dim intZahlen(6) As Integer Dim a As Integer Dim sortiert As Boolean Dim temp As Integer Dim zaehler As Integer lstlotto.Clear Const DEF_Max = 49 i = 1 Do Randomize intZahlen(i) = Int(Rnd() * DEF_Max) + 1 'Innere Schleife For a = 1 To i If intZahlen(i) = intZahlen(a) And a <> i Then i = i - 1 Exit For End If Next i = i + 1 Loop Until i > 6 Do sortiert = True For i = 1 To 5 If intZahlen(i) > intZahlen(i + 1) Then temp = intZahlen(i + 1) intZahlen(i + 1) = intZahlen(i) intZahlen(i) = temp sortiert = False End If Next i Loop Until sortiert = True i = 1 Do lstlotto.AddItem intZahlen(i) i = i + 1 Loop Until i > 6 End Sub
Ähnliche Themen
-
Java Bubblesort
Von moemaster im Forum JavaAntworten: 2Letzter Beitrag: 24.01.11, 13:23 -
Bubblesort-Ausgabe
Von barosch im Forum Java GrundlagenAntworten: 3Letzter Beitrag: 25.10.08, 13:26 -
Frage zu einem Bubblesort
Von glitterangel im Forum Delphi, Kylix, PascalAntworten: 6Letzter Beitrag: 10.04.05, 20:14 -
Bubblesort...wie?
Von tremere im Forum Visual Basic 6.0Antworten: 3Letzter Beitrag: 10.01.05, 12:47 -
Bubblesort mit Marke
Von Patrick Kamin im Forum Delphi, Kylix, PascalAntworten: 2Letzter Beitrag: 12.12.02, 20:44





Zitieren

Login





